MARC Train is pleased to announce that Penn Line Train 401 will return to service on Tuesday, October 14.  Train 401 was suspended in April 2024 to support Amtrak's state of good repair and ADA accessibility construction work at stations between Baltimore and Washington.

Amtrak's work is still underway and requires the maximum amount of time overnight with no trains operating to ensure that projects are finished on time and on budget.  At the present time, Train 401 cannot depart Penn Station before 4:30am to avoid impacting this ongoing work.  The schedule of Train 401 has been designed to meet this 4:30am departure requirement and also arrive at New Carrollton for the second Washington Metrorail departure of the morning.  With the restoration of Train 401, Train 403 will return to a 4:50am departure from Penn Station, five minutes later than its current departure time.

A new Penn Line timetable will not be produced at this time.  A special supplemental schedule insert has been created that customers can print, cut, and place inside the current Penn Line timetable.  You can also download a copy to keep on your mobile device.  Click the following links to download:
